logo

Output 11563d82ce793533e9955b111d9a3bc3fcc7e7e1745fc51aae2b360f244003e4:0

value
18730864078
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f4deb458b55d1e7647f1e253d1337afaf7a9424 OP_EQUALVERIFY OP_CHECKSIG
address
1Ku8DcqyeKYeNej7C91svp9nFMcTdx2aoY
transaction
11563d82ce793533e9955b111d9a3bc3fcc7e7e1745fc51aae2b360f244003e4